A cell phone company charges $15 for 120 minutes. What is the cost per minute? Round to the nearest cent.

Answer: The cost per minute is $0.13 or 13 cents.

Step-by-step explanation:

If it charges $15 for 120 minutes  then to get to one minute we will have to divide it by 120.

so 15/120 =  0.125  which rounds to 0.13 to the nearest cent.
